
Web3 is saturated with new startups and it can be hard to stand out. Tailored marketing can help cut through the noise. Regardless of their unique selling propositions, projects with an effective marketing strategy will always have the upper hand.
While there are many nuances to effective Web3 marketing, there are five basic rules that are fundamental to nailing the perfect Web3 marketing strategy.
These are:
- Defining Your Unique Value Proposition
- Educating Your Audience
- Engaging With the Community
- Optimizing Web Presence
- Showcasing Your Success Stories
Rule 1: Define Your Unique Value Proposition
Over 1,800 projects are running on Web3 technology; therefore, differentiation is key. To stand out in the competitive Web3 space, it is crucial to clearly define your startup’s Unique Value Proposition (UVP).
Your UVP should answer two fundamental questions: What problem does your project solve, and how does it differentiate itself from existing solutions? Web3 technology was born in 2014 which is relatively nascent compared to its Web2 counterpart that has existed since the late 90s. As with all emerging industries, Web3 has its problems: security hacks, phishing, user experience and more. Therefore, projects that market themselves as solutions will inevitably attract users who have been held up or affected by these relative problems.
Furthermore, a well-defined UVP helps to define the right audience. It allows clear identification of the specific needs, desires, and pain points of the target market. This alignment ensures that marketing efforts are focused and tailored to resonate with intended audiences, increasing the chances of attracting and retaining users.
Example: Lido

Lido’s UVP addressed two of the greatest problems around accessibility in the run-up to the Shanghai Upgrade: sufficient capital and locked-up assets. Lido positioned itself as a solution by allowing people to stake as much as they wanted, without locking up their assets via staked ETH derivatives. This has allowed Lido to target a very wide audience as a consequence.
Rule 2: Educate Your Audience
Web3 technology comes with jargon and it is always changing. Words like Accounts Abstraction, Maximal Extractable Value (MEV) or Zero-Knowledge are always cropping up on crypto Twitter feeds. Even the most clued up about the space do not fully understand all the technology behind it all.
Demystifying concepts empowers users to use this technology. Therefore being the go-to source of understanding puts startups in perfect stead as being the platform where people will use this technology. This will help to attract complete beginners and intermediates alike. Furthermore, education is fundamental to attracting more experienced users. Educating them on the nuances that make a certain form of technology unique and advantageous to that of a rival will grab the attention of experienced users.
Additionally, many Web3 services suffer from poor user experience. Offering comprehensive tutorials through blogs and social media can provide a valuable opportunity to become an educational thought leader. By empowering your audience with knowledge, you not only enhance their experience but also build trust and credibility.
Example: CoinGecko

CoinGecko has numerous educational materials: blogs, glossaries, a YouTube channel and so on. As a cryptocurrency aggregator, producing informative educational materials has helped to solidify its position as one of the most reliable aggregators and sources of information in the industry.
Rule 3: Engage with Your Community
Community financial support and advocacy are central to the success of Web3 projects. As such, trust becomes a fundamental aspect of Web3 marketing strategies. Startups that actively engage and foster this trust with their community gain a significant advantage
Actively engaging with the community helps to build relationships and establish trust with potential users, investors, and stakeholders. When the community sees a genuine interest in their opinions, concerns, and feedback, they are more likely to become loyal advocates for your project, spreading the word and attracting more users. By actively engaging with the community, you tap into this marketing potential.
Participating in relevant forums, social media channels, and online communities where target audiences reside is essential. Actively listen, respond to queries, provide valuable insights, and encourage discussions. Hosting Ask Me Anything sessions (AMAs) and participating in X(fka Twitter) Spaces with thought leaders in the Web3 space will further strengthen your community engagement efforts.
Example: Aave

Aave has successfully engaged with its community in several ways. Through regular Tweets, it has kept its community in touch with upcoming announcements. Furthermore, it has participated in Spaces and AMAs taking the opportunity to respond to the questions of its community.
Rule 4: Optimize Your Web Presence
Establishing a strong online presence is crucial for effective marketing in any industry, and Web3 is no exception. Given the rapid growth of Web3, it can be challenging to keep up with these innovations and gain the audience’s attention which is why implementing search engine optimization (SEO) strategies is essential.
X(fka Twitter) plays a central role in showing that your business is informed about the latest developments in Web3. Actively participating in discussions, sharing updates, and providing insight is a perfect way to leverage these stories to gain traction. The platform’s potential to comment on news stories and share engaging content is essential. Consistent tweeting, whether in the form of threads or regular updates, helps maintain the attention of target audiences.
Example: Uniswap

Uniswap has endeavoured to build a strong web presence by posting on X(fka Twitter) regularly and creating a YouTube Channel to build its presence outside of X(fka Twitter).
Rule 5: Showcase Your Success Stories
Given that there have been so many bad actors, scams and Ponzi schemes within the industry, sharing success stories, data points, case studies and testimonials is fundamental for creating trust. This can be achieved by highlighting how a project has improved industries, solved existing problems, or empowered users. These examples serve as powerful tools to instil confidence in potential users. Moreover, with many people questioning the real-life use cases of blockchain technology, success stories are a means to show a startup’s practical applications.
